The term Forky primarily refers to a specific fictional character introduced in the global cinematic landscape through Disney and Pixar's 2019 animated feature, Toy Story 4. Unlike the traditional toys in the franchise, such as Woody the cowboy or Buzz Lightyear the space ranger, Forky is a 'hand-made' toy. He was created by the character Bonnie during her kindergarten orientation. Physically, he is a white plastic spork—a hybrid utensil that is part spoon and part fork—adorned with googly eyes of mismatched sizes, a red pipe cleaner for arms, a popsicle stick broken in half for feet held together by blue modeling clay, and a small bit of yarn for a mouth. This physical composition is crucial to understanding the word because it defines the character's initial existential crisis: he does not believe he is a toy; he believes he is trash. People use the name Forky not just to identify the character, but often as a cultural shorthand for something that is DIY, repurposed, or someone who feels out of place in their current environment. In a broader linguistic sense, 'Forky' has become a symbol of the 'imposter syndrome' or the struggle to accept a new identity that differs from one's original purpose.

When fans of the movie use the word, they are often referencing the character's catchphrase, 'I am trash!' or his frantic energy. The character is voiced by Tony Hale, whose performance gave the name a specific neurotic and high-pitched connotation. In social media contexts, a 'Forky' moment might refer to a time when someone feels overwhelmed by a situation they weren't designed for. For example, a student might say they feel like Forky during a difficult advanced mathematics exam, implying they feel like a simple tool thrown into a complex world. The word carries a heavy dose of irony and self-deprecating humor. Furthermore, the design of Forky has led to a surge in 'Forky-style' crafts in schools, where children take disposable items and turn them into characters. Thus, the word has transitioned from a simple character name to a verb-like concept of 'making something from nothing'.

In pedagogical settings, teachers might use Forky as a way to discuss recycling and environmentalism. Because Forky is made of single-use plastic, he opens up conversations about the lifecycle of objects. Is a spork still a spork if it has googly eyes? Is it trash if a child loves it? These philosophical questions are baked into the very name. In the movie's narrative, Forky's journey is one of moving from a disposable mindset to a permanent one. Therefore, using the word often evokes themes of belonging and self-worth. Finally, the word is used in commercial contexts. You will see 'Forky' on merchandise, clothing, and in toy aisles. Interestingly, the 'Forky' toy sold in stores is a plastic replica of a toy made of trash, which creates a recursive loop of consumerism that the character himself would likely find confusing. This meta-commentary is often discussed in film studies and marketing classes. To 'be a Forky' in a business sense might mean being a product that succeeded despite its humble or unconventional beginnings. The word is deeply rooted in the 21st-century animation culture and continues to be a popular reference in memes about existential dread and the absurdity of modern life.

You will encounter the word Forky in a variety of modern environments, ranging from digital media to physical retail spaces. The most obvious place is within the Disney+ ecosystem, where the character stars in his own series of shorts titled Forky Asks a Question. In these episodes, the word is repeated constantly as he explores various concepts like love, time, and cheese. If you are in a household with young children, 'Forky' is likely a household name, appearing on pajamas, lunchboxes, and in daily play. Parents often use the word when discussing their children's favorite characters or when engaging in craft activities. It is a staple of the 'Disney Parent' vocabulary.

In the world of internet memes, 'Forky' has a life of its own. You might see a picture of a messy room with the caption 'Forky was here,' or a video of someone failing at a simple task with the character's voice saying 'I am trash!' dubbed over it. This usage transcends the movie itself and enters the realm of 'internet slang' for being a mess or feeling inadequate. In these cases, you hear the word used as a relatable icon for the struggles of adulthood, despite him being a children's character. The contrast between his innocent appearance and his deep existential crisis makes him a favorite for older audiences who enjoy dark humor.

The character was almost named 'Sporky', but director Josh Cooley decided 'Forky' sounded more like a name a young child (Bonnie) would actually give him.

The name 'Forky' was created by the writers at Pixar Animation Studios for the 2019 film Toy Story 4. It is a diminutive form of the word 'fork', despite the character being a spork.
